I'm disappointed in myself that I didn't think of > it. > > Earlier today, I decided to check on Monica's Pine. At this time of year, her > tree's crown can be seen from our upstairs bedroom window, which gives me a > higher vantage point to view the crown. From the spot I chose to measure > Monica's pine, the distance from my eye to the top twig was 42.5 yards. I > obtained this reading repeatedly as the light gradually changed. The crown > angle was 45.8 degrees, which was an average of 10 readings. That gave me > 91.4 feet above eye level. The distance to the base was computed by a similar > method of repeated shooting. The distance was 37 yards at an angle to 22.6 > degrees. This produced 42.7 feet. Let's see now, 91.4 + 42.7 = 134.1 feet. > Monica's pine stands a mere 87 feet from our back door. Can anyone in ENTS > top that for a tall tree so close to their front or back door and on their > property?
